What is A4 Printer Paper?
A4 paper determines 210 mm x 297 mm (8.27 inches x 11.69 inches) and belongs to the ISO 216 standard, which is commonly accepted in many countries around the world. Particularly developed for both printing and writing, A4 paper is a versatile medium, accommodating a series of printers, photo copiers, and other office devices.
Table 1: A4 Paper Dimensions
| Measurement | Size |
|---|---|
| Width | 210 mm |
| Height | 297 mm |
| Width | 8.27 inches |
| Height | 11.69 inches |
Types of A4 Printer Paper
A4 printer paper comes in different types and finishes, each serving various functions. Here is a list of the most typical types of A4 paper:
Standard Copy Paper
- Weight: 70-80 GSM (grams per square meter)
- Use: Everyday printing, photocopying, and documents.
Picture Paper
- Weight: 200-300 GSM
- Complete: Glossy or matte
- Usage: High-quality pictures, pamphlets, and marketing products.
Cardstock
- Weight: 160-250 GSM
- Use: Business cards, invitations, and tough documents.
Recycled Paper
- Weight: 70-90 GSM
- Use: Environmentally friendly printing.
Specialized Paper
- Weight: Varies
- Types: Colored, textured, and metallic surfaces.
- Use: Creative jobs, art prints, and crafts.
Table 2: Comparison of A4 Paper Types
| Type | Weight (GSM) | Finish | Advised Use |
|---|---|---|---|
| Standard Copy Paper | 70-80 | Smooth | Daily printing |
| Picture Paper | 200-300 | Glossy/Matte | Premium photos |
| Cardstock | 160-250 | Smooth | Company cards, invites |
| Recycled Paper | 70-90 | Smooth | Environmentally friendly printing |
| Specialty Paper | Differs | Numerous | Creative tasks, art prints |

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. What weight of A4 paper should I use for printing documents?
For most everyday documents, a basic weight of 70-80 GSM is ideal. For color printing or discussion materials, consider using much heavier paper (90-120 GSM).
2. Can I use A4 paper in all printers?
A lot of printers are developed to deal with A4 paper, but it's necessary to check the printer specifications. Some printers might have restrictions on paper weight or type.
3. Is image paper worth the investment?
If premium images and dynamic prints are essential, investing in photo paper is rewarding. Nevertheless, for standard file printing, standard copy paper is enough.
4. What is the distinction in between matte and glossy photo paper?
Matte image paper has a non-reflective surface, making it ideal for a softer finish, while glossy photo paper provides lively colors and sharp details with a shiny finish.
5. How can I save unused A4 paper to preserve its quality?
Store A4 paper in a cool, dry place far from direct sunshine, and keep it in its initial packaging until required. Prevent saving it near moisture or heat sources.
